RECORD NUMBER OF REGISTRATIONS FOR CHARLOTTE PRO LEAGUE

The 2021 Charlotte Pro League kicked off this week with the player Draft on Sunday, followed by the Draft reveal on Monday. Both events were held at the site of our Presenting Sponsor, Town Brewing Co. With the highest number of registrations in the seventeen year history of the Pro League, 148 players were drafted to 8 men’s teams and 4 women’s teams. Join us for Opening Night on Thursday, June 17 at 7:00 PM when all team matches will be played at Olde Providence Racquet Club.

The season begins on Thursday, June 17 at 7:00 PM with all matches being played at Olde Providence Racquet Club. All tennis enthusiasts are invited to check out the action and watch the best players in Charlotte compete.

The Charlotte Tennis Association and Special Olympics Mecklenburg County have partnered to create a Unified Doubles Summer Series. In Unified Doubles, a player with an intellectual disability (a Special Olympics athlete) partners with a player without an intellectual disability (a Unified partner), to compete together against similarly paired opponents.
